Origin : Dominican Republic Format : Perfecto Size : 6.0? x 47 Wrapper : Sun Grown Rosado Filler : Dominican Binder : Dominican Hand-Made Price : $9 each
Lately I haven’t been able to hangout at my local cigar shop or on the online cigar forums as much as I once was. Life happens and with a wife, a dog, and two small kids my free time is nearly non-existent. So I was very surprised when I walked into my local shop after being gone for a while to find these new Hemingways sitting in the humidor. I guess I have fallen a little out of touch. After letting them sit in my humidor for the past month I am ready to spark this thing up and see what we have here.
I know very little about this version of the Hemingway. Is it a one time deal, a very rare release, or only somewhat rare like the Maduros? I have no idea but I bought a couple just in case I never see them again. Glad I did. the Rosado wrapper is a nice change-up for this smoke. The Signature Maduro is probably my all time favorite Hemingway Series cigar. I like this size and the Maduro wrapped version is just spectacular. The Rosado is nearly as good in a completely different way. It has a mild spice with a touch of cinnamon in there, all stacked on top of a core of leather and wood. I even picked up some subtle flashes of what I’d describe as applewood at times. It is a smooth medium body smoke and a real treat.

The 858 Rosado is probably one of my favorite cigars of all time (seriously). So when I heard these were coming out at the end of last year I was very excited.
Being that the Hemingway line is more full bodied than the regular line, I was concerned that the Rosado flavors would be obscured in a bolder blend. In some ways I was right. This cigar did not taste like the 858 Rosados. It did not have the creamy leather, wood and cinnamon notes I love about the 858, but it was still good – just in a different way. It was much spicier and had some clove and pepper notes that built throughout the smoke. There was some roughness around the edges with this cigar, but I really enjoyed it.
